Katherine Heigl Defends Herself And Her R-Rated Movie

Pin It

Katherine Heigl says some people have labeled her the "foot-in-the-mouth-gal" for some of her public comments (such as her criticism of the ‘Grey’s Anatomy’ writers for her storyline material a couple of seasons ago and her criticism of ‘Knocked Up’), and she has a response for those people.

"I keep thinking, In what way? Because I said something you don’t agree
with? Because I said something you don’t like? I’m just telling you my
opinion. I hate the idea that I can’t be honest about how I feel about
things because it’s going to pi** somebody off who feels differently.
That seems preposterous to me."

She also has no qualms about her latest romantic comedy, ‘The Ugly Truth,’ being R-rated.

"I didn’t want to do another PG-13 movie," she says in the August issue of InStyle.
"[In any real-life contentious relationship with romantic
underpinnings] you’re probably going to drop the F-bomb once in a
while. You’re probably going to say some things that are kind of harsh.
And you’re definitely going to talk about sex. It doesn’t have to be so
Snow White and Prince Charming. That’s my problem with a lot of
romantic comedies: Everyone spends so much time trying to make sure
it’s the fairytale because that’s what the rating calls for."
